Guzma and N are lowkey two sides of the same fucked up, manipulated little coin.
Both want the best for their respective groups (Guzma wants to support his crew of misfits, M wants to improve conditions for pokemon)
Both were manipulated by people they sought validation and guidance from. (It was a lot less personal for Guzma, but you can still tell that it felt good to think someone outside of his crew believed in his strength)
Both revolt against the expected status quo (Guzma resents the antiquated aspects of the island challenge and rejects Kukui's proposal of introducing a league to Alola, which to him is just a foreinger's take on the island challenges with all the same problems he has with the island challenge, and N seeks to free pokemon from their trainers under the manipulated belief that pokemon only suffer under human hands)
The main difference is their approach- which, aside from just generally being different people, can partly be attributed to the fact that N was highly isolated as a child and wasn't the one Directly Experiencing the injustice he wishes to correct as an adult. Guzma, however, was actually rather frequently under the spotlight, if all the trophies he had is an indication, and he was the one directly experiencing the pressure to be better, be stronger. He was the one being directly affected by people's perceptions of second and third place being something to be disappointed and upset about.
